AboutThisCourse

As human rights issues continue to dominate headlines worldwide, there is a growing demand for journalists who can cover these stories with sensitivity, depth, and nuance. This course prepares learners to meet this demand by providing them with the tools and techniques necessary to produce high-quality human rights reporting. Through a combination of expert instruction, hands-on exercises, and real-world examples, this course covers a range of topics, including interviewing techniques, source evaluation, storytelling, and multimedia production. By the end of the course, learners will have a solid foundation in human rights reporting, giving them a competitive edge in their careers and making a positive impact on the world.
